  • Publication number: 20240143968
    Abstract: A system, method, and computer-readable medium are disclosed for performing a data center asset management and monitoring operation. The data center asset management and monitoring operation includes: receiving data center asset health information from respective data center assets from a plurality of data center assets; generating a neural network graph using the data center asset health information from the plurality of respective data center assets, the neural network graph comprising a plurality of nodes; calculating node edge weights based upon how similar certain data center assets are to other data center assets; and, calculating a data center asset health score using the neural network graph.

  • Patent number: 11924026
    Abstract: A system, method, and computer-readable medium for performing a data center asset alert operation. The data center asset alert operation includes: monitoring a plurality of data center assets; determining when a first data center asset of the plurality of data center assets generates a first data center asset alert; determining when a second data center asset of the plurality of data center asserts generates a second data center asset alert; determining when the first data center alert and the second data center alert are substantively similar; and, generating a recommendation when the first data center alert and the second data center alert are substantively similar.

  • Patent number: 11665536
    Abstract: An information handling system includes a wireless management controller having a first wireless network interface used to establish a secure short-range wireless network connection between a management controller and a mobile device. A second wireless network interface establishes a peer-to-peer wireless network connection between the management controller and the mobile device. The management controller stores a secure shell public key received from the mobile device through the secure short-range wireless network connection. The management controller randomly identifies a port number for the peer-to-peer wireless network connection, and disables network traffic through other ports associated with the peer-to-peer wireless network connection.

  • Patent number: 11644801
    Abstract: A mechanism is provided for utilizing localized clusters within a mesh network to aid in tracking environmental factors associated with information handling systems in an environment having a large number of information handling systems installed. Sensors within each information handling system measure a variety of environmental factors, such as, for example, temperature (CPU, ambient, air inlet, air exhaust, system board, and the like), air flow through the information handling system, fan speed, and hardware utilization. The sensor-derived environmental information is provided to a lead local cluster node, which can provide local responses to environmental values exceeding thresholds. Lead nodes generate a mapping of the environmental factors and provide that mapping to a data center management server.

  • Patent number: 11166253
    Abstract: A mechanism is provided for utilizing location services of a mesh network to aid in tracking the presence and location of information handling systems in an environment having a large number of systems installed. In one embodiment, each information handling system joins a mesh network to form localized clusters. Mesh network location services aid the new system in finding a vertically-closest node in the cluster or a neighboring cluster. With this information, the new system can determine in which rack the system is installed. This information can then be provided to an inventory management system for inclusion of the information handling system in an inventory tracking database. Embodiments are also configured to determine when an information handling system is removed from the mesh network and can inform the inventory management system of the removal in order to determine whether additional steps need to be taken in response.

  • Patent number: 10972361
    Abstract: An information handling system for managing equipment in a datacenter includes a display, a wireless communication interface, and an imaging system configured to capture image data from within a field of view of the imaging system. The information handling system shows the image data on the display, and provides an augmented reality overlay on the display over the image data. The augmented reality overlay locates an element of datacenter equipment that needs to be serviced. The information handling system further determines that the element is within the field of view, establishes a wireless communication link with the element via the wireless communication interface in response to determining that the element is within the field of view, and receives an instruction to service the element from a remote service system in response to establishing the wireless communication link.

  • Patent number: 10966342
    Abstract: An information handling system for identifying equipment in a datacenter establishes a wireless communication link with an element of datacenter equipment, and receives identification information from the element. The identification information distinguishes the element from other elements of the datacenter equipment that are visibly indistinct from the first element. The information handling system further captures image data when the field of view of an imaging system includes the element, displays the image data on a display, matches a portion of the image data with an image object associated with the first and second elements, determines an identity of the element based upon the identification information and the image object, and displays an augmented reality overlay on the display over the image data. The augmented reality overlay co-locates the image object with the portion and includes the identity over the portion.
